Green Business Accreditation

What is Green Business Accreditation?

Green Business Accreditation is a certification that recognizes a company’s commitment to environmentally sustainable practices. The accreditation aims to promote and reward environmentally-friendly business strategies, with the goal of mitigating the negative impacts of business activities on the environment.

How does it work?

An organization applies for Green Business Accreditation through an accrediting body that assesses their environmental practices. This includes reviewing the company’s energy usage, waste management, water conservation, and overall environmental impact. The company may need to demonstrate a commitment to ongoing improvement in these areas. Once the accrediting body is satisfied that the company meets its standards, it awards the Green Business Accreditation. This accreditation is not permanent; to maintain it, the company must continue to meet the standards set by the accrediting body.

How to Get Started

To begin the process of earning Green Business Accreditation, a company needs to evaluate its current environmental practices and identify areas for improvement. The company should then develop a plan for implementing more sustainable practices, which may involve investing in energy-efficient equipment, reducing waste, or sourcing materials more sustainably. Once the company has made these changes, it can apply for accreditation through an accrediting body, providing evidence of its commitment to environmental sustainability.
